I finally started playing MVS games with my Phantom-1 and a modded Japanese AES. Every MVS game I play with that pairing has sound glitches in the music; Pochi & Nyaa has no sound at all (except at the initial Neo Geo splash screen). I've had almost no trouble at all with my Phantom-1 on my US console.

So, I was wondering: What might cause the problem with the Phantom-1 + Japanese console pairing? AES carts work perfectly in the Japanese unit. The sound troubles only occur constantly when I use the Phantom-1 in that unit.

Also, is it something that can be fixed, or would I need to get a different Japanese AES? The serial number on my Japanese AES is 187537 if that might information might be of any use.

P1's have problems with AES model 3-6. Check what model you have by popping off the top and looking for the large white letter and the far left hand side of the mobo.

Also, new games like Pochi to Nya have a new type of encryption that was not present when the P1 was designed, therefore it may not function perfectly.

I've had problems with MSX and MOTW, both games made in 99, furthermore, they both use uncoventional chipsets. Eventually I just broke down and got the homecarts :drool:

If you limit your P1 use to older games, you should be fine. Also there is a good thread still stickied about what Playmore games with function with the P1.
